Description of Noplok.org Redirect Virus

 

Noplok.org redirect virus means that a malicious code has taken over and modified the settings of your browser without your knowledge,with a lot of pop-up windows related to their other products flood into your browser, turning your surfing experience into a nightmare. An increase in traffic to the website will mean a lot of sales and online profits for attackers. It makes profit by letting PC users click per-click-paid techniques on this Noplok.org site. In a word, the ultimate purpose of creating this redirect virus is to make money. Computer users have to be more and more carefully when they are browsing with the infected computer because any pop-ups can be dangerous as leading them to visit unsafe sites and causing unwanted further PC problems.

 

 

Noplok.org Virus Consequences

 

Once installed successfully on the affected computer, it carries out a lot of spiteful activities silently in the background. Then, you will notice that the default homepage and search engine of your browser is replaced by Noplok.org . This redirect virus will badly lower users’ browsing experience since it often causes users browsers to be redirected to its own page or other unknown websites. It delivers a lot of pop-ups to the infected computer in order to trick users into clicking on them. Those advertisements include discounts, deals, pop-banners and other types of promotions may be bogus and tend to cheat users to purchase useless services or fake products. If users click on those pop ups and buy the promoted products or services, they would end up losing their money without getting anything back. Furthermore, gather privacy related information from the traces is its another purpose which is used for analyzing user’ habits.

 

Guide to Remove Noplok.org Redirect Virus from the Infected PC

 

1. Disable running processes on Windows Task Manager.
1) Press Ctrl+Alt+Del keys to activate Windows Task Manager.

 


2) From Processes tab, find out the associated processes of the threat and then right click on the End Process button to totally terminate them.

 

 


2. Uninstall associated programs of Noplok.org from the computer.


1)Click on Start button, click Control Panel.


2) Click Program, click on Uninstall a Program.

 


3) From Programs and Features, locate the associated programs of the browser hijacker from the applications list, locate the associated programs and then click Uninstall button to remove them.


4) Confirm the uninstall request then follow the wizard to complete the removal.


3. Modify browser settings to stay away from the cyber attacks triggered by the redirect virus.

1) Enable the browser.
2) Revert browser settings and fully remove the associated Internet temp files.


For Internet Explorer
Click Tools-> Go to Internet Options-> Click Advanced tab-> Click on Reset button

 


For Mozilla Firefox
Click Firefox-> locate Help option-> Go to Troubleshooting Information-> Click Reset Firefox button


For Google Chrome
Click the wrench icon-> Click Settings-> Click Show Advanced Settings link-> Click Reset Browser Settings
3) Reset the browser homepage manually.


For Internet Explorer
Click General from the Internet Options -> type a secure and new web address -> confirm the modification


For Mozilla Firefox
Click Options from the Firefox menu-> Click General tab-> type a secure and new web address -> confirm the changes.

For Google Chrome


Go to Advance section in the Settings-> Click Show Home Button-> Click the displayed Change link-> type a secure and new web address


4) Restart the browser to confirm the modification.
